【技术实现步骤摘要】
一种卷烟厂滤棒库仓储系统双堆垛机调度方法及存储介质
[0001]本专利技术涉及卷烟厂滤棒库仓储
,具体涉及一种卷烟厂滤棒库仓储系统双堆垛机调度方法及存储介质。
技术介绍
[0002]传统立体仓储系统一般由计算机管理的信息系统和由PLC管理的堆垛机控制系统两个部分组成。通常情况下堆垛机任务执行的顺序是按照计算机系统下达任务的先后来执行的。在卷烟厂滤棒库运用仓储系统时,同一轨道上的两台堆垛机分别在各自区域执行任务,堆垛机的调度要考虑生产过程中的卷包机台及发射机台等生产所需的物料、生产的节拍、要料的时间要求、缺料的时间要求、堵料的时间要求等数据,而这些数据通常都由计算机系统通过接口传递,堆垛机控制系统并不能对任务执行顺序做出有效的调整,容易出现长时间不执行某一机组任务而引起机台断料的情况;此外,若生产任务大幅增加,原先的设计能力冗余将无法满足需要,经常造成断料情况,影响生产节奏。因此,急需找到一种合理的调度堆垛机的方法,以提升堆垛机的复合作业效率。
技术实现思路
[0003]为解决现有技术中的不足,本专利技术 ...
【技术保护点】
【技术特征摘要】
1.一种卷烟厂滤棒库仓储系统双堆垛机调度方法,其特征在于,包括:确定最晚开始时间步骤:根据机台断料时间和堆垛机运动参数确定每条任务的最晚开始时间;优先级划分步骤:根据所述最晚开始时间划分任务优先级;排序步骤:根据所述任务优先级对任务进行排序,得到整体队列,并列举出所述整体队列的所有排序情况;确定空跑距离步骤:确定整体队列所有排序情况的堆垛机空跑距离;时空模型构建步骤:按照堆垛机空跑距离对整体队列所有排序情况进行排列,空跑距离越短越靠前,然后按照排列后的顺序构建时空模型,并判断构建的时空模型是否满足选取要求,若满足选取要求,则选取该时空模型;若不满足,则选取下一排列构建时空模型;若所有时空模型均不满足,则选取空跑距离最短的时空模型;任务下达步骤:基于选取的时空模型,依次将时空模型中的任务下达给堆垛机。2.如权利要求1所述的方法,其特征在于,所述确定最晚开始时间步骤包括:确定机台断料时间;所述机台断料时间包括成型机断料时间或发射机断料时间;确定堆垛机完成任务所需的时间;所述每条任务的最晚开始时间不少于机台断料时间、堆垛机完成任务所需的时间和任务生成的时间之和。3.如权利要求2所述的方法,其特征在于,所述成型机断料时间TC=CH/CN;所述发射机断料时间TF=FH/FN;其中:CH为成型机申请出盘后缓存滤棒格子的数量;CN为成型机对应工单的品牌的生产能力;FH为发射机申请出盘后缓存滤棒格子的数量;FN为发射机所有管道对应的卷烟机生产能力总和。4.如权利要求3所述的方法,其特征在于,其中,X
i
为i号卷烟机正在使用的管道数量,x
i
为i号卷烟机正在使用的管道中从发射机K号管道中接出的管道数量,N
i
为i号卷烟机消耗滤棒的能力。5.如权利要求2所述的方法,其特征在于,所述堆垛机完成任务所需的时间T=T1+t;其中...
【专利技术属性】
技术研发人员:许俊,王响雷,姚正亚,冷顺天,蒋护君,马视曾,严胜田,段骏,李琰,宋伟杰,
申请(专利权)人:昆船智能技术股份有限公司,
类型:发明
国别省市:
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。